ABOUT CYBERTROL Cybertrol Engineering creates and delivers custom-engineered automation hardware and software solutions to manufacturing customers throughout the upper Midwest and across the world. The firm is privately owned, headquartered in Minneapolis, and has additional offices in Madison and Marshfield, WI. There is an extraordinarily strong engineering culture that emphasizes both personal and professional growth along with a commitment to providing high-quality solutions, including: plant-wide automation, information, and industrial IT (Information Technology) infrastructure; custom control panel design and fabrication; and upgrades of obsolete automation systems. Job Responsibilities In this role, you will be directly responsible for developing and implementing PLC/HMI (Programmable Logic Controllers/Human Machine Interface) code, including simulation and process commissioning at customer sites. As part of this work, you will create clear and well-structured Functional Specifications and the required PLC/HMI programs working in a team as a contributor or technical lead.  You will also partner with a team of Digital Manufacturing, Hardware, and Industrial IT engineers to deliver comprehensive projects that meet customer requirements. During these projects, you will become a trusted consultant for Cybertrol’s customers.  Some examples of specific Industrial Controls & Systems Integration Engineer responsibilities include: Engage directly with the customer to develop a complete understanding of the customer and their needs and create a Functional Specification of the full deliverable. Maintain customer contact throughout the life of the project and for some time after commissioning. Develop the PLC/HMI code in a team environment in a modern software framework. Ensure that quality processes have been followed to deliver zero-defect code to the customer during site installation. Work independently as required to deliver solutions in the area of subject matter expertise. Provide technical leadership as required, including system-level thinking and problem-solving techniques. Working with multiple disciplines and trades while leading the commissioning of projects. Up to 50% travel may be required. This travel includes product lifecycle, trade shows, or other product related travel. A valid driver’s license is required. Required Qualifications B.S. in Engineering  (Electrical, Computer, Mechanical, or Chemical) or related engineering field  with 5 years minimum related and relevant experience in industrial automation OR Associate Degree  in Engineering Technology (Electrical, Computer, IT, or Electro-Mechanical) or a related engineering technology field  with 5 years minimum related and relevant experience in industrial automation. Technical leadership capability to guide, and coach team members working on complex projects. Proficient in programming  and delivering projects in a team environment. Strong written and oral communication skills. Curiosity and agility in problem solving when presented with a new challenge. Focus and tenacity when given a challenge to see it through. Goal oriented with the strong desire to learn new technologies and concepts. Desired Qualifications Six-Sigma or Lean experience. Experience working around live industrial control panels and components. Experience with Agile Scrum development processes. Experience with the following technologies: PLC platforms such as Rockwell Automation, ControlLogix, Siemens S7, etc.   Automatic PLC code generation tools such as Rockwell Automation ACM. Stand-alone and distributed HMI/SCADA platforms such as FTView SE/ME, Siemens WinCC, Wonderware Intouch/System Platform, Ignition, etc. Legacy PLCs and HMI/SCADA platforms. VFDs, Process Instrumentation, Robotics/Servo Control, Valve Control, etc. Safety Control Systems – PLCs and Relays. Industrial networks for device control such as Ethernet/IP, Profibus PA/DP, ASi, IOLink, HART, DeviceNet, etc.   P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S & WORKING CONDITIONS  Office Work:    Office desk/cubicle environment    Extensive computer use  Occasional Control panel IO powered checkouts in panel shop or customer site     Site Work:   Up to 50% travel to industrial manufacturing facilities. Typical locations are in North America.  Rarely travel to other continents.   Overnight travel from a few days to several days at a time.  Travel duration rarely exceeds twelve days in a row.   Ability to consistently lift 50 lbs.     On-Site working conditions may include:  Work around construction equipment and personnel.  Work around production equipment and production personnel.  Work in hot or cold areas.  Work in noisy areas.  Work up and down stairs, indoors and outdoors.  Electrical/Instrumentation Device Checkout and Troubleshooting. Includes voltage testing, equipment troubleshooting on a ladder, and light electrical assembly – signal wiring in control panels/instruments. Working and interfacing with operations, engineering, equipment supply, and construction personnel.   Typical Personnel Protective Equipment (PPE) Required: Safety Glasses, Steel Toed shoes, hearing protection, and electrical safety PPE. Employees must comply with customer specific requirements and PPE.   Work may include working weekends, holidays, nightshift, and extended hours to meet deadlines and commissioning requirements.  Occasionally on-site work can be 12+ hours/day.  Cybertrol offers a discretionary bonus to all employees, based on company and personal performance.
